Output 59889583a4af229bcf580fc86d11f8ebe576aa00b34a799e6879a948c40d4e27:9

value
22388345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10357e7f9dc6322efff7e2f13ab84ab0beba594d OP_EQUAL
address
M9Ns8LWKe8FiNYBf8jyjsGV7XaPcmw8JA5
transaction
59889583a4af229bcf580fc86d11f8ebe576aa00b34a799e6879a948c40d4e27
spent
true